Performance Center Manager, Ard-Ts
The Performance Center Manager (PCM) serves as the local installation SME for the program matters, and leads, manages and directs contractor staff assigned to their respective program Performance Center (PC).
- Coordinates with local installation leadership (Brigade and below) to plan, prepare and execute resilience and performance education training.
- Participates in the Army Community Health Promotion Council and serve as the primary POC for Master Resilience Trainer (MRT) Level 1 training.
- Ensures quality control of all Master Resilience Trainer-Performance Experts (MRT-PE) to include Professional Certification, MRT progression to higher levels and conduct rehearsals for training presentations to ensure MRTs are "ready to teach.
"
- Conducts local program Quality Assurance/Quality Enhancement and provide required reports.
- Develops the program Training Schedule at their respective installation and providing a draft training schedule to the ACOR for approval.
